|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Membre du Club
![]() Étudiant Inscription : janvier 2011 Messages : 330 ![]() |
bonjours j'ai un petit soucis
alors j'aimerais bien automatiser certaines tâche sur excel donc le soucis est que j'ai une colonne contenant des mois et une colonne contenant un lien vers un ficher par exemple colonne1 colonne2 Mars \XXX\[XXXX - Mars.xls] donc j'aimerai savoir comment récuperer le Mars de la cellule de la colonne1 et la mettre dans le liens voila merci d'avance |
|
|
00
|
|
|
#2 | |
|
Office & Excel ![]() ![]() ![]() |
Salut.
Avec le mois en A1, tu peux utiliser en B1 la formule suivante: Citation:
__________________
"Plus les hommes seront éclairés, plus ils seront libres" (Voltaire) --------------- Ma nouvelle vidéo: comparer des listes via une MFC - Mes articles sur DVP Vous souhaitez rédiger pour DVP? Contactez-moi Amoureux de la langue française? Venez corriger nos ressources VBA pour Excel? Pensez D'ABORD en EXCEL avant de penser en VBA... N'oubliez pas de VOTER (en bas à droite d'un message) --------------- |
|
|
00
|
|
|
#3 |
|
Membre du Club
![]() Étudiant Inscription : janvier 2011 Messages : 330 ![]() |
visiblement ça ne semble pas marcher j'ai peut etre pas tout mis
enfaite je vais reprendre la formule =RECHERCHEV(D2345;'S:\XXXX\XXXX\XXXXX\XXX\2011\[Janvier.xls]Feuil1'!A:C;2;FAUX) quand je l'applique sur cette formule ca ne marche pas |
|
|
00
|
|
|
#4 | |
|
Office & Excel ![]() ![]() ![]() |
Au temps pour moi... J'ai lu "Lien" et j'ai compris "lien hypertexte"...
RechercheV attend une plage valide en second argument. Ici, tu dois recomposer le nom de la plage puisque tu y insères une variable (le contenu d'une autre cellule) et du dois donc utiliser INDIRECT. Il faut, en outre, que le classeur cible soit ouvert. Toujours avec le nom de la feuille en A1 Citation:
__________________
"Plus les hommes seront éclairés, plus ils seront libres" (Voltaire) --------------- Ma nouvelle vidéo: comparer des listes via une MFC - Mes articles sur DVP Vous souhaitez rédiger pour DVP? Contactez-moi Amoureux de la langue française? Venez corriger nos ressources VBA pour Excel? Pensez D'ABORD en EXCEL avant de penser en VBA... N'oubliez pas de VOTER (en bas à droite d'un message) --------------- |
|
|
00
|
|
|
#5 |
|
Membre du Club
![]() Étudiant Inscription : janvier 2011 Messages : 330 ![]() |
non visiblement ça ne marche toujours sans doute parceque j'ai oublié de préciser
=RECHERCHEV(A8;INDIRECT("'D:\Données\[STAT " & a1 & ".xlsx]Feuil1'!A:C");2;0) |
|
|
00
|
|
|
#6 |
|
Office & Excel ![]() ![]() ![]() |
Il faudrait essayer avec le nom exact et dire si ça fonctionne...
__________________
"Plus les hommes seront éclairés, plus ils seront libres" (Voltaire) --------------- Ma nouvelle vidéo: comparer des listes via une MFC - Mes articles sur DVP Vous souhaitez rédiger pour DVP? Contactez-moi Amoureux de la langue française? Venez corriger nos ressources VBA pour Excel? Pensez D'ABORD en EXCEL avant de penser en VBA... N'oubliez pas de VOTER (en bas à droite d'un message) --------------- |
|
00
|
|
|
#7 |
|
Membre du Club
![]() Étudiant Inscription : janvier 2011 Messages : 330 ![]() |
j'ai pas bien saisie?
|
|
|
00
|
|
|
#8 | |
|
Office & Excel ![]() ![]() ![]() |
Ben...
Qu'est-ce que cela donne avec Citation:
__________________
"Plus les hommes seront éclairés, plus ils seront libres" (Voltaire) --------------- Ma nouvelle vidéo: comparer des listes via une MFC - Mes articles sur DVP Vous souhaitez rédiger pour DVP? Contactez-moi Amoureux de la langue française? Venez corriger nos ressources VBA pour Excel? Pensez D'ABORD en EXCEL avant de penser en VBA... N'oubliez pas de VOTER (en bas à droite d'un message) --------------- |
|
|
00
|
|
|
#9 |
|
Membre du Club
![]() Étudiant Inscription : janvier 2011 Messages : 330 ![]() |
ben j'ai essayer et ça me donne un #REF erreur du à une référence non valide
|
|
|
00
|
|
|
#10 |
|
Office & Excel ![]() ![]() ![]() |
Ton fichier Cible doit être ouvert car INDIRECT ne travaille pas sur un fichier fermé.
Tu dois aussi t'assurer d'avoir bien recomposer le chemin et le nom exact du fichier. Cela dit, ce n'est pas le top de travailler de cette manière sur des fichiers, puisque si j'ai bien compris, tu vas devoir ouvrir tous les fichiers pour être sûr que la saisie dans la liste de validation permette de pointer vers un fichier ouvert. Il sera à mon avis nécessaire de rapatrier les données du fichier en VBA en fonction du choix fait dans la liste, puis de faire pointer le RECHERCHEV sur la plage rapatriée... A toi de voir.
__________________
"Plus les hommes seront éclairés, plus ils seront libres" (Voltaire) --------------- Ma nouvelle vidéo: comparer des listes via une MFC - Mes articles sur DVP Vous souhaitez rédiger pour DVP? Contactez-moi Amoureux de la langue française? Venez corriger nos ressources VBA pour Excel? Pensez D'ABORD en EXCEL avant de penser en VBA... N'oubliez pas de VOTER (en bas à droite d'un message) --------------- |
|
00
|
|
|
#11 |
|
Membre du Club
![]() Étudiant Inscription : janvier 2011 Messages : 330 ![]() |
oula ce n'est pas de mon niveau enfin je ne vois pas comment faire une rechercheV dans du vba
ça m'a l'air trop compliqué |
|
|
00
|
|
|
#12 |
|
Office & Excel ![]() ![]() ![]() |
Tu peux aussi recomposer la formule RECHERCHEV en VBA, mais je ne vois pas comment échapper au VBA dans le cas que tu proposes.
Pour voir comment recomposer RECHERCHEV en VBA, tu peux aller voir mon tuto sur le sujet.
__________________
"Plus les hommes seront éclairés, plus ils seront libres" (Voltaire) --------------- Ma nouvelle vidéo: comparer des listes via une MFC - Mes articles sur DVP Vous souhaitez rédiger pour DVP? Contactez-moi Amoureux de la langue française? Venez corriger nos ressources VBA pour Excel? Pensez D'ABORD en EXCEL avant de penser en VBA... N'oubliez pas de VOTER (en bas à droite d'un message) --------------- |
|
00
|
|
|
#13 |
|
Office & Excel ![]() ![]() ![]() |
Il ne s'agit pas, dans ce cas-ci, de refaire le RECHERCHEV dans le VBA, mais de rapatrier par VBA les données dans une plage de feuille du classeur actif et d'utiliser RECHERCHEV sur cette plage.
__________________
"Plus les hommes seront éclairés, plus ils seront libres" (Voltaire) --------------- Ma nouvelle vidéo: comparer des listes via une MFC - Mes articles sur DVP Vous souhaitez rédiger pour DVP? Contactez-moi Amoureux de la langue française? Venez corriger nos ressources VBA pour Excel? Pensez D'ABORD en EXCEL avant de penser en VBA... N'oubliez pas de VOTER (en bas à droite d'un message) --------------- |
|
00
|
|
|
#14 |
|
Membre du Club
![]() Étudiant Inscription : janvier 2011 Messages : 330 ![]() |
ah d'accord
bon je vais faire un tour sur ton tuto et essayer de l'adapter à mes besoins merci |
|
|
00
|
|
|
#15 |
|
Office & Excel ![]() ![]() ![]() |
N'hésite pas à revenir, on te guidera en fonction du choix que tu feras.
Bon courage.
__________________
"Plus les hommes seront éclairés, plus ils seront libres" (Voltaire) --------------- Ma nouvelle vidéo: comparer des listes via une MFC - Mes articles sur DVP Vous souhaitez rédiger pour DVP? Contactez-moi Amoureux de la langue française? Venez corriger nos ressources VBA pour Excel? Pensez D'ABORD en EXCEL avant de penser en VBA... N'oubliez pas de VOTER (en bas à droite d'un message) --------------- |
|
00
|
Copyright © 2000-2012 - www.developpez.com